Chapter 18 is Live!


As of 10:00 AM NST, Chapter 18—the FINAL chapter—of the plot is now live! And Vocivus was defeated to 0 HP at 9:53 AM this morning!

First things first, visit the hub and click into the story to begin reading Chapter 18.

The 4,000 plot point chapter limit is still in effect, and your point limit has been reset back to 0 for this chapter to earn more points. Enjoy earning plot points for the activities you want to participate in.

We will be making updates to our plot guide over the course of today.

Here's what's new, and live (keep watch on this list as we update):

  • 4,000 point earning limit during Chapter 18, which should be 1 week long—and this is IT! The FINAL chapter!!
  • Read all of Chapter 18 to earn +13 points
  • The final achievement, Paint the Town Red is now unlockable, along with the Act IV completion bonus
  • This chapter does not contain any new puzzles
  • Continue collecting your Void Essences for +50 points each day (which does not count towards the chapter max!)
  • Volunteer at the Hospital, where shifts award +40 points each
  • Fight in the Battledome
  • Continue earning points towards your Adventure Pass, if you have tiers left on the free track or have purchased the NC track

@ mercy_graves and others - I know I keep preaching this, but it's because it worked so well for me despite my utter lack of interest in the Battledome: please, I hope you'll all train your pets. It's so worth it, because good plot prizes and achievements frequently rely on Battledome victories against tough opponents.

Having a well-trained Battledome pet also means it's quicker and easier to do daily battles, which award good prizes such as codestones and nerkmids. I paid for my Battledome training almost entirely by doing daily battles.

The prize store for this plot also has some of the top weapons in the game (Wand of the Dark Faerie which deals a lot of damage and does some healing, Thyoras Tear which is an excellent once-per-battle shield that blocks all damage, Thunder Sticks which is a once-per-battle guaranteed freeze against your opponent that also does damage, Grapes of Wrath which is a big damage dealer at a cheap price...), and Leaded Elemental Vial gives a once-per-battle full heal and recently became very affordable due to being a reward during the plot.

JN's training guide will help you get your pet trained for the least expense. Please consider it. Your future self will be thanking you (as I am thanking my previous self right now).

For those wondering what they will call Queen Fyora now that she's no longer queen, likely still Queen Fyora. There has been a few Kings, Emperors, & Queens who have either abdicated or lost their reign (like a Queen whose husband died and rule went to the next male heir) but kept their royal title as an honorary one. Here's an article about it:

https://europeanroyalhistory.wordpress.com/2019/01/18/abdication-what-to-call-a-former-monarch-part-v/

Now some do choose to downgrade their title to a lesser one, but I'm going to guess Fyora is going to keep her honorary royal title as "Queen" because:

* (1) Lorewise it's what she's been known as for so long and many beings see her as such (like she's still the most naturally powerful being in all of Neopia. Iridesia just so happened to have the power which counteracts Drakara-Jennumara, but otherwise I'd put her power level to the likes of Jhudora, Illusen, Mira, & Aethia (though Aethia may have less raw magical power to instead opt in enhanced martial skill).
* (2) Metawise its convenient for merch, both future and existing.

Though Fyora put Iridesia and Luxinia in charge of forming the new council, even if it's not an immediate addition I have to think Fyora would have a position on it. Like this abdication thing kind of feels like a knee-jerk reaction, the whole situation with Drakara just bringing back all the bad memories (including choices she has made as ruler she might be looking back as being wrong ones). Forming the council is a wise decision, but wanting to runaway from duty isn't. ATM Fyora just needs some time to get through her thoughts & feelings, also maybe talk with a therapist (actually maybe quite a few of the characters in this plot need to talk with one:..).
